Deal Hunter

A voice-first shopping copilot. Ask for a product out loud and Deal Hunter searches live web data for current listings, ranks them cheapest-first, reads the best options back to you, and remembers items you want to watch.

Built on three technologies, one job each:

  • LiveKit — real-time voice (speech-to-text, the LLM brain, and text-to-speech) via LiveKit Inference.
  • Bright Data — live web search (SERP + Web Unlocker) for real, current product prices.
  • Moss — semantic retrieval and per-user memory (your watch list, budget, and preferences).

How it works

You speak
  -> LiveKit STT (speech -> text)
  -> LLM decides to call a tool
       -> find_deals      -> Bright Data SERP -> live listings -> ranked cheapest-first
       -> remember_fact   -> Moss memory (watch this / my budget)
       -> recall_facts    -> Moss memory (scoped to you)
  -> LiveKit TTS (spoken summary)  +  live "Best Prices" cards in the browser

Project structure

agent-py/                 # Python LiveKit voice agent
  src/agent.py            # agent entrypoint + tools (find_deals, memory, knowledge)
  src/deal_hunter/
    finder.py             # price search: Bright Data SERP -> ranked deals -> voice summary
    web_research.py       # Bright Data SERP + Unlocker helpers
  src/create_index.py     # seeds the Moss knowledge + memory indexes
  tests/                  # pytest suite
frontend/                 # Next.js app: landing + live voice UI with deal cards
